I had to start going to Boarding school when I started grade 10 due to various reasons ( so I was 15 at the time ) I loved every second of boarding school. I was also in a all girls school which I also really loved ( before that in primary school and grade 8 and 9 I was in a co-ed school ). I truly flourished in boarding school as I am such a social person I just loved having all my friends down the hall from me. Ofcourse I felt homesick from time to time and I remember once after I had just started going crying to mom that I want to come home. She stood firm and said I need to give it another few months and once I settled in every thing changed

I am very happy that my mom did not take my out when I asked and new that it was just that I have missing home a bit
My younger sister that is more an introvert did not cope well in boarding school and was very unhappy and homesick. My parents later then decided to take her out. I was given the option to do so but dint even consider it for a moment.
I really think it depends on your child. I do not think there is a right or wrong choice here I think it is what is best for you and your child. There where many girls in boarding school with me that did not like it and there where loads that like me loved it. It really depends on your child.
Also please do keep in mind I went to boarding school as a teenager and I am sure the experience for both parent and child is very different if they are younger.
